Correlation
The correlation between TDC and GEHC is 0.32,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

TDC vs. GEHC - Profitability Comparison
TDC -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Teradata Corporation reported a gross profit of 256.00M and revenue of 421.00M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 60.8%.
GEHC -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, GE HealthCare Technologies Inc. reported a gross profit of 2.54B and revenue of 4.67B.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 54.3%.
TDC -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Teradata Corporation reported an operating income of 52.00M and revenue of 421.00M, resulting in an operating margin of 12.4%.
GEHC -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, GE HealthCare Technologies Inc. reported an operating income of 664.00M and revenue of 4.67B, resulting in an operating margin of 14.2%.
TDC -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Teradata Corporation reported a net income of 37.00M and revenue of 421.00M, resulting in a net margin of 8.8%.
GEHC -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, GE HealthCare Technologies Inc. reported a net income of 184.00M and revenue of 4.67B, resulting in a net margin of 3.9%.
